是一种在前端开发中常见的需求,可以通过以下步骤实现:
<h:commandButton value="Submit" action="#{bean.submit}" onclick="closeModalPanel()" />
这里的bean.submit
是一个后端方法,用于处理提交操作。onclick
属性指定了在按钮点击时要执行的JavaScript函数closeModalPanel()
。
closeModalPanel()
函数,用于关闭模式面板。可以使用PrimeFaces提供的组件和方法来实现。例如:function closeModalPanel() {
PF('modalPanelWidgetVar').hide();
}
这里的modalPanelWidgetVar
是模式面板的组件变量名,可以根据实际情况进行修改。
public void submit() {
// 处理提交操作的业务逻辑
// 返回页面或执行其他操作
}
至此,调用h:commandButton submit后关闭模式面板的功能就实现了。
关于模式面板的概念,它是一种常见的前端组件,用于在页面上展示一块浮动的面板,通常用于显示弹出窗口、对话框、提示信息等。模式面板可以提供良好的用户交互体验,增强页面的功能和可用性。
模式面板的优势包括:
模式面板的应用场景包括:
腾讯云提供了一系列与前端开发和云计算相关的产品,可以根据具体需求选择适合的产品。以下是一些推荐的腾讯云产品和产品介绍链接地址:
请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估和决策。
领取专属 10元无门槛券
手把手带您无忧上云